Transaction 7b24de23913d67a5e330e72a460573c2f321aecb2aaf796260db94028a9eda24
1 Input
1 Output
-
7b24de23913d67a5e330e72a460573c2f321aecb2aaf796260db94028a9eda24:0
- value
- 106000
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d84adb1beb0fdbfd4fdadbf6e30399cdc83aeca
- address
- bc1qmkz2mvd7kr7ml48a4klkuvpennwg8tk2ymr5kx